They still haven't responded to mine, over 24 hrs. Paid for a renewal which has not been performed several days ago and been waiting 10 mins for live support.

Edit:- finally got through to their live support, which was helpful. It appears renewals are taking a long time as they are actually a transfer, as registerfly is transferring names that were previously held at different registrars (although under the guise of registerfly) into being 'genuinely' registered by themselves. i.e. they used to be a reseller and now they are a registrar in their own right.
